### Runbook: BounceBroom — Account Recovery

If the BounceBroom email bounce processor loses access to its service account, do not create a new one. First, pause the intake queue so bounces buffer safely. Then open the recovery console and select the BounceBroom principal. Verification requires approval from the on-call lead. Once approved, the console prompts for the stored recovery credentials; enter the passphrase that appears directly below this paragraph.

recovery phrase for fahof-kahap: holion-gormir-jorix-istix-briwyn-sorael

### Account Recovery — Catalogue Import (Lintwood)

Quick one for review: when the Lintwood catalogue import wipes a patron's session table, the recovery flow re-seeds accounts from the nightly snapshot. Check that the importer skips locked accounts — last time it didn't. To rerun recovery against staging you'll need the vault passphrase, which is appended just below.

recovery phrase for yafof-tajof: julmir-kelax-julvan-holath-belvan-holir-ralael-ralvan-ralath-julvan-silmir-istmir-kaswyn-ulamir

OFF-SITE RUN CHECKLIST — Item 12: Courier Change

Following the missed pick-up at the Eastmoor depot last Wednesday, Barrowfield Transit is suspended from this route. All off-site runs now use Lanternway Couriers until further review. Dispatch desk: confirm the Lanternway booking reference against the day sheet, verify the rider's badge on arrival, and record the time in the run log. Before releasing the satchel, the desk must give the rider the following instruction:

dispatch memo: the quenax olidor courier leaves the lamvan aldath keliel ledger at gate 2085 under passcode 005795

Subject: Renewal of the Vollander Components Supply Contract

Team,

Ahead of Thursday's session, please review the proposed renewal terms with Vollander Components. The draft extends supply of the Keldric line by three years, with indexed pricing and a volume rebate negotiated by Pria Halvesen. Finance should confirm the rebate treatment before signature. Switching-cost analysis supports renewal over the alternative bid from Norrowtec. Our related commercial intentions are captured in the confidential note below.

board note of kageg-bahof: The renewal with Holwynax Holdings closes at $2 million a year, 5 percent below the last contract. Project Ulaath slips by two quarters because of the supplier delay.